Recognizing the Duty of a Medical Gas Plumbing Technician

Clinical gas pipes is a specific area that plays a vital function in health care centers. These qualified professionals are in charge of the setup, upkeep, and fixing of clinical gas systems that deliver important gases such as oxygen, laughing gas, and clinical air to numerous areas within health centers and facilities. With the consistent advancements in clinical innovation and an ever-growing demand for security, the role of a clinical gas plumbing has become progressively vital in making sure patient care continues to be uninterrupted and efficient.

A medical gas plumbing technician must possess a deep understanding of different regulatory criteria and codes that control the installation and monitoring of clinical gas systems. This includes standards from organizations like the National Fire Security Association (NFPA) and the American National Criteria Institute (ANSI). By adhering to these guidelines, medical gas plumbing technicians aid lessen dangers related to gas leaks, devices failings, or inappropriate installation of medical gas shipment systems.

Training and qualification are critical components for any type of medical gas plumbing. In many cases, striving specialists must finish a certain training program that consists of both academic education and hands-on experience. Afterward, they have to pass a certification examination to show their knowledge and competency in clinical gas plumbing. Continual education and learning is also crucial in this field, as new technologies and policies are frequently presented, guaranteeing that plumbing professionals stay up-to-date on the most effective practices and safety criteria.

A Brief History of Fireworks

The origins of fireworks trace back to ancient China, where bamboo shoots were thrown into a fire, creating explosive sounds. By the 7th century, the Chinese developed gunpowder, leading to the creation of the first true fireworks. These creations eventually made their way to Europe in the 13th century, where they became celebrated features of public events. Over time, the technology evolved, leading to increasingly complex and colorful displays.

The Science Behind Fireworks

At the heart of every firework lies a combination of chemistry and engineering. A typical firework consists of a shell filled with various chemical compounds that produce color, sound, and effects. Gunpowder serves as the propellant, enabling the firework to ascend into the sky.

When ignited, the gunpowder creates a rapid expansion of gas, pushing the shell upward. Once it reaches the desired altitude, a fuse ignites a star composition within the shell, resulting in an explosion. The colors you see are the result of different metal salts; for instance, strontium yields red, barium produces green, and sodium results in yellow. This blending of chemistry creates the stunning visual experience that captivates audiences.

Types of Fireworks

Fireworks come in various styles and formats, each with unique effects. Aerial shells shoot high into the sky, exploding into brilliant bursts, while ground-based fireworks, like fountains, produce colored lights and sparks on the ground. Sparklers, popular at events like birthday parties, offer a personal touch, allowing individuals to spell out messages or create designs in the air.

The design process for fireworks is meticulous. Pyrotechnicians carefully select the composition of each firework, keeping in mind factors such as burn rate, diameter, and the explosion pattern. The artistry involved in arranging these compounds results in breathtaking displays that can leave spectators in awe.

Safety First

While fireworks bring joy, they can also pose dangers if not handled correctly. Safety precautions are essential for ensuring a hazard-free celebration. Always observe local laws regarding fireworks, as some areas may restrict their use.

When using fireworks, choose a safe, open area free from flammable materials. Have a water source or fire extinguisher nearby, and consider wearing protective eyewear. Never attempt to relight malfunctioning fireworks, and always supervise children closely if they are involved.

Certifications and credentials are another crucial factor to consider. The chimney service industry has several certifications that indicate a provider’s commitment to high standards of safety and workmanship. One of the most respected certifications is from the Chimney Safety Institute of America (CSIA). A CSIA-certified chimney sweep has undergone rigorous training and testing to ensure they have the knowledge and skills necessary to perform chimney inspections, cleanings, and repairs safely and effectively. Additionally, some providers may hold certifications from other organizations like the National Fireplace Institute (NFI), which further demonstrates their expertise in the field.

Understanding Pain and Its Causes

Before we delve into the best pain treatments, it’s essential to understand the different types of pain and their underlying causes. Pain can be classified into two main categories: acute pain and chronic pain. Acute pain is typically short-term and is often associated with an injury or illness. On the other hand, chronic pain persists for more than six months and can be caused by various factors, such as nerve damage, arthritis, or fibromyalgia.

When it comes to managing pain, it’s crucial to identify the root cause of your discomfort. By understanding the underlying factors contributing to your pain, you can work with your healthcare provider to develop a personalized treatment plan that targets the source of your discomfort.

Non-Pharmacological Pain Treatments

If you’re looking for natural and non-invasive ways to manage your pain, there are several non-pharmacological pain treatments available to help you find relief. These treatments focus on holistic approaches to pain management, addressing not only the physical symptoms but also the emotional and psychological aspects of pain.

1. Physical Therapy: Physical therapy involves exercises and techniques designed to improve mobility, strength, and flexibility, reducing pain and promoting healing. It can be especially beneficial for individuals with musculoskeletal pain or injuries.

2. Acupuncture: Acupuncture is an ancient Chinese practice that involves inserting thin needles into specific points on the body to reduce pain and promote healing. Many people find relief from chronic pain conditions, such as migraines, back pain, and arthritis, through acupuncture treatments.

3. Massage Therapy: Massage therapy can help relax muscles, improve circulation, and reduce tension, leading to pain relief and increased mobility. Different types of massages, such as Swedish massage, deep tissue massage, or trigger point therapy, can be tailored to address your specific pain concerns.

Pharmacological Pain Treatments

For more severe or persistent pain, pharmacological treatments may be necessary to help manage your symptoms effectively. These treatments typically involve medications that target pain receptors in the body, providing relief from discomfort. It’s essential to work closely with your healthcare provider to determine the most appropriate medication for your specific pain condition.

1. Over-the-Counter Medications: Non-prescription pain relievers, such as acetaminophen, ibuprofen, or naproxen, can be effective in managing mild to moderate pain. These medications work by reducing inflammation and blocking pain signals in the body.

2. Prescription Medications: In cases of severe or chronic pain, your healthcare provider may prescribe stronger pain medications, such as opioids, muscle relaxants, or antidepressants. These medications should be used under careful supervision due to their potential for addiction and side effects.

3. Topical Treatments: Topical pain relievers, such as creams, gels, or patches, can be applied directly to the skin to target localized pain. These treatments are particularly useful for arthritis pain, muscle soreness, or nerve pain.
